5 Reasons to Have Adequate Coverage:

1. Protecting Your Home: Homeowners insurance provides coverage for damage to your home caused by fire, storms, theft, vandalism, and other disasters. Adequate coverage ensures that you will be able to repair or rebuild your home in the event of a covered loss.

2. Protecting Your Belongings: Home insurance also covers your personal belongings, such as furniture, clothing, electronics, and other items, in case of damage or theft. Having adequate coverage means that you will be able to replace your belongings if they are damaged or stolen.

3. Liability Protection: Homeowners insurance also provides liability protection in case someone is injured on your property. Adequate coverage will help cover medical expenses and legal fees if you are found liable for an accident on your property.

4. Mortgage Requirements: Most mortgage lenders require homeowners to carry insurance to protect their investment. Adequate coverage ensures that you meet your lender’s requirements and protect your investment in your home.

5. Peace of Mind: Having adequate coverage gives you peace of mind knowing that you are protected in case of an unexpected event. Knowing that your home and belongings are covered can help alleviate stress and worry.

4 Ways to Save on Policy Rates:

1. Shop Around: One of the best ways to save on homeowners insurance is to shop around and compare rates from multiple insurance companies. Different insurers may offer different rates, so it’s important to get quotes from several companies to find the best deal.

2. Increase Your Deductible: A higher deductible can lower your insurance premiums. By choosing a higher deductible, you can save money on your monthly premiums, but it’s important to make sure you can afford the deductible in case you need to file a claim.

3. Bundle Your Policies: Many insurance companies offer discounts for bundling multiple policies, such as homeowners and auto insurance. By bundling your policies with the same insurer, you can save money on both policies.

4. Improve Home Security: Installing security systems, smoke alarms, and deadbolt locks can help lower your insurance premiums. Insurance companies often offer discounts for homes with added security measures in place.

4 Different Types of Homes Needing Home Insurance:

1. Single-Family Homes: Single-family homes are the most common type of home that requires homeowners insurance. This type of home is typically a detached house with its own land and requires insurance to protect the structure and belongings inside.

2. Condominiums: Condo owners also need homeowners insurance, but the coverage may vary depending on the condo association’s master policy. Condo insurance typically covers the interior of the unit, personal belongings, and liability protection.

3. Mobile Homes: Mobile homes, also known as manufactured homes, require specialized insurance coverage. Mobile home insurance protects the structure, personal belongings, and liability in case of damage or theft.

4. Vacation Homes: Vacation homes or second homes also need homeowners insurance to protect the property and belongings. Vacation home insurance may have different coverage options than a primary residence, so it’s important to discuss your needs with your insurance agent.

Common Questions About Homeowners Insurance:

1. What does homeowners insurance cover?

Homeowners insurance typically covers damage to your home, personal belongings, and liability protection. It may also cover additional living expenses if you are unable to live in your home due to a covered loss.

2. How much homeowners insurance do I need?

The amount of homeowners insurance you need depends on the value of your home and belongings. It’s important to have enough coverage to rebuild your home and replace your belongings in case of a covered loss.

3. What factors affect homeowners insurance rates?

Several factors can affect homeowners insurance rates, including the location of your home, the age and condition of the home, the coverage limits, the deductible amount, and your claims history.

4. Can I save money by bundling my home and auto insurance?

Yes, many insurance companies offer discounts for bundling multiple policies, such as homeowners and auto insurance. By bundling your policies with the same insurer, you can save money on both policies.

5. What is a deductible?

A deductible is the amount you are responsible for paying out of pocket before your insurance coverage kicks in. A higher deductible can lower your insurance premiums, but it’s important to make sure you can afford the deductible in case of a claim.

6. How can I lower my homeowners insurance premiums?

There are several ways to lower your homeowners insurance premiums, such as shopping around for the best rates, increasing your deductible, bundling your policies, and improving home security with alarms and locks.

7. Do I need flood insurance?

Flood insurance is typically not included in standard homeowners insurance policies and may need to be purchased separately. If you live in a flood-prone area, it’s important to consider adding flood insurance to protect your home and belongings.

8. Can I make changes to my policy?

Yes, you can make changes to your homeowners insurance policy, such as updating coverage limits, adding or removing endorsements, or changing your deductible. It’s important to review your policy regularly and make adjustments as needed.

9. What is liability coverage?

Liability coverage protects you in case someone is injured on your property and you are found liable for the accident. Liability coverage can help cover medical expenses and legal fees if you are sued for damages.

10. How can I file a homeowners insurance claim?

If you need to file a homeowners insurance claim, you can contact your insurance company or agent to start the claims process. It’s important to document the damage and provide any necessary information to support your claim.

11. What is replacement cost coverage?

Replacement cost coverage is a type of coverage that pays to replace or repair damaged items at their current value without deducting for depreciation. This type of coverage can help ensure that you can replace your belongings with new items.

12. What is actual cash value coverage?

Actual cash value coverage is a type of coverage that pays the depreciated value of damaged items at the time of the loss. This type of coverage may result in a lower payout than replacement cost coverage, as it takes depreciation into account.

13. How often should I review my homeowners insurance policy?

It’s a good idea to review your homeowners insurance policy at least once a year to make sure you have adequate coverage and are getting the best rates. Life changes, such as renovations, additions, or changes in occupancy, may require updates to your policy.
